Question 1025565: An escalator lifts people to the second floor of a building, 25 feet above the first floor. The escalator Rises at a 30° angle. To the nearest Foot, how far does a person travel from the bottom to the top of the escalator Answer by Alan3354(69443) (Show Source):

y = 25 ft
sin(30) = y/r = 0.5
r = 50 ft
